A STUDY OF THE EFFECT OF PT/TIO2 COATED ON HOLLOW GLASS POTOCATALYTIC OXIDATION OF SODIUM PENTACHLOROPHENOLATE

摘要

Titanium dioxide (TiO_2) samples were prepared by hydrolysis tetrabutyl titanate in various water to alcoxide ratios and sintering the hydrolysis product at different temperatures. Then the titanium dioxide loaded with platinum varying from 0.2% to 2.4% by weight and coated on hollow glass beads. The photocatalytic degradation rate of Sodium pentachlorophenolate (PCP-Na ) was dependent on preparing conditions such as: Sintering temperatures, water to alcoxide ratios( R), platinum content, sodium silicate quantity and the size of hollow glass beads granules. The proper conditions of preparation photocatalysts are as follws: R is 100, sintering temperature is 650 °C ,the ratio of TiO_2 : sodium silicate : hollow glass beads : platinum is 10: 5: 20: 0.15 (w/w) and the size of hollow glass is 0.5—1mm. Under these conditions, the ratio between anatase and rutile of the photocatalyst is 2:1, and the potocatalytic activity is high.
